Output 81e27c34bbd25ac6c0b0f431f8bddc4d28e59fdb208984df1e0f578030c5c291:17

value
5551913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75f31ae208c94ef531a4cc94a8231c77a909870a OP_EQUAL
address
3CSgDDj8JrP2Jtk322a7v1qn5tkgGdfVTU
transaction
81e27c34bbd25ac6c0b0f431f8bddc4d28e59fdb208984df1e0f578030c5c291